Human Astrocytes and Hypoxia
Scott Allen
University of Sheffield
Hypoxia is a feature of neurodegenerative diseases, and can both directly and indirectly impact on neuronal function through modulation of glial function. Astrocytes play a key role in regulating homeostasis within the central nervous system, and mediate hypoxia-induced changes in response to reduced oxygen availability. Scott Allen discusses a detailed characterization of hypoxia-induced changes in the transcriptomic profile of astrocytes in vitro. Read the Study
